In 2023, the poultry meat market size in Angola stood at 320.0 thousand metric tons, showing a minor year-on-year decrease of 0.93%. Over the last five years, the market experienced an average annual decline of 2.44%, indicating a downward trend. However, the year-on-year variations since 2014 have shown considerable fluctuations, including significant decreases in 2015 and 2020, and notable recoveries in 2017 and 2021.
Looking forward, the forecasted data from 2024 to 2028 suggests a continued gradual decline, with the market size expected to decrease at an average annual rate of 0.84%. The overall projected five-year growth rate is -4.11%, pointing to a slight contraction in market volume.
